WebDec 8, 2024 · This connection requires tracking small changes (milliseconds) in the intervals between successive heartbeats (Fig 1), also called "RR intervals". This is different from heart rate, which just averages the number of beats per minute. WebSignal processing was performed offline. ECG signal was firstly filtered using a 0.05–40 Hz band-pass filter. The Pan and Tompkins method was used to locate the R peaks, and thus the RR interval time series were constructed. RR intervals with ectopic beats were detected and excluded using the combination method . PCG signals were firstly ... WebA widely used one (Bazett formula) is the square root method, obtained by dividing the actual QT interval by the square root of the RR interval. Using the square root method: Normally the QTc is between about 0.33 sec (330 msec) and about 0.44 sec or (440 msec).
